My girl Tawny is great in so many ways, but she has no social skills around other dogs, and in fact is still very fearful around them, especially when she is restrained. I wanted to see if we could improve that part of her personality. Becca Riker, owner of The Mutt Hutt, was willing to help me with that by introducing her to the pack at her daycare. I have 100% confidence in Becca and her staff, so I knew Tawny was in good hands.
It was a great day! Here's a pictorial of what happened.

The process begins. Does Tawny look a little nervous? She was. I however, was not.

Tawny was slowly introduced to a few dogs, while the staff watched for any signs of aggression. There were none. One dog's early approach shows Tawny very uncertain.

Sitting is a good sign, especially near a calm dog.

A tentative sniff shows progress.
